Specifications

 

• Common Name: Wax Plant / Hoya
• Botanical Name: Hoya carnosa (general Hoyas from seed vary slightly)
• Variety: Wax Plant
• Flower Color: Usually white/pink star-shaped blooms
• Plant Type: Perennial Tropical Vine
• Blooming Season: Spring to Summer
• Sun Exposure: Bright Indirect Light
• Soil Type: Well-drained, airy potting mix
• Watering Needs: Moderate; allow soil to dry between waterings
• Germination Time: 14–35 days
• Temperature Range: 18–30°C (64–86°F)
• Planting Depth: Surface sow or lightly cover
• Spacing: 8–12 inches when potting multiple plants
• Plant Height: 1–4 feet indoors (longer vines if supported)
• Maintenance Level: Easy
• USDA Zones: 9–11 (commonly grown indoors worldwide)
• GMO Status: Non-GMO
• Suitable For: Indoor pots, hanging baskets, balconies, and decorative indoor displays

 

Planting Guide

 

• Sow seeds on the surface of airy, well-draining soil and lightly cover.
• Keep soil moist but never waterlogged until seedlings emerge.
• Place in bright, indirect light for best growth.
• Maintain consistent warmth for faster germination.
• Transplant seedlings to individual pots once they develop 2–3 leaves.
• Allow soil to dry slightly between waterings to prevent root rot.
• Provide support if growing as a climbing or trailing plant.
